A Reader's Opinion: ROMANCING MR. BRIDGERTON by Julia Quinn

The Book
Penelope Featherington has secretly adored her best friend's brother for . . . well, it feels like forever. After half a lifetime of watching Colin Bridgerton from afar, she thinks she knows everything about him, until she stumbles across his deepest secret . . . and fears she doesn't know him at all.

Colin Bridgerton is tired of being thought nothing but an empty-headed charmer, tired of everyone's preoccupation with the notorious gossip columnist Lady Whistledown, who can't seem to publish an edition without mentioning him in the first paragraph. But when Colin returns to London from a trip aboard he discovers nothing in his life is quite the same—especially Penelope Featherington! The girl haunting his dreams. 

But when he discovers that Penelope has secrets of her own, this elusive bachelor must decide . . . is she his biggest threat—or his promise of a happy ending?

A Reader's Opinion
I've read this particular Bridgerton book twice now and found it just as delightful the second time around.  Colin Bridgerton is charming, playful, and such a sweetheart. Penelope is the girl not everyone may notice at a party, but when they do, realize they'd missed out on making a great friend. Quinn writes witty dialogue and enjoyable characters who offer up steady banter, plenty of smiles, and even a few "ahhh" moments. I highly recommend the Bridgerton series for anyone who enjoys a light read and plenty of romance. You won't be disappointed!

Series Note: It should be mentioned that I've read up through On the Way to the Wedding. My last "favorite" in this series was When He Was Wicked.

2nd Note: I picked up the latest edition which contains the 2nd epilogue. I hadn't read this before, nor did I finish it, but I must say the story could have done without it. The original ending is perfect and needed nothing more . . . in this reader's opinion.
